Koji Yamamura!

Last Thursday I had the pleasure of hearing Koji Yamamura lecture at RISD. He's an award-winning animator with a really lovely style. Recently he did an adaptation of Kafka's 1919 short story "A Country Doctor." We saw clips of this, along with several of his other animations including "The Old Crocodile," "Fig," and "A Child's Metaphysics." He may be most famous for "Mt. Head," which was nominated for an Oscar in 2003.

I wasn't able to find "Fig" online -- it was my favorite -- but instead here I have "The Old Crocodile" and also a trailer for "The Country Doctor."

His website is also worth a look, it includes some whimsical little Flash animations.

Ryan: His lecture was not very in-depth... he spoke some English okay but mostly had a translator. He told us a bit of how he started drawing when he was very young, etc. Many people asked questions about why/how he chose the subject matter for his stories, and what he was trying to say with his animations, and his response was almost always "Just watch the animation! If I could say it in words I wouldn't have to make an animation." Which I thought was a little badass :]
